The collision happened on the A27 at Patching between the Coach and Horse pub and the junction of the A280 shortly before 8pm.
The cyclist, a 77-year-old man from Goring-by-Sea, suffered a serious head injury and was taken to the Royal Sussex County Hospital in Brighton.

Hide AdLater that evening, his condition was described as stable and not life-threatening, police have said.
The driver of the Peugeot Boxer 290, a 73-year-old woman from Braintree, Essex, was not injured.
The westbound carriageway of the A27 was closed while the incident was dealt with and reopened at 11.30pm.
